The aim of this study was to examine the effect of polyphenol quercetin on morphological changes in nonalcoholic fatty liver disease (NAFLD) in rats fed high-fructose diet. Material and methods. For 20 weeks animals (n=8 in each group) of the 1 st group were given standard diet and water; the 2 nd group - standard diet and 20% fructose solution; the 3 rd group - standard diet with quercetin supplementation (0.1%) and 20% fructose solution. Formalin-fixed and paraffin-embedded liver samples were sectioned, stained (hematoxilin and eosin, Van Gieson's stain), evaluated with the use of the SAF and NAS scales. Results and discussion. Histological assessment did not reveal pathology in the structure of the liver of the 1 st group rats (SOAOFO; NAS - 0, fibrosis - 0). The 2 nd group rat livers disclosed micro-, mid- and macrovesicular steatosis, inflammation without ballooning, pericellular and periportal fibrosis (S2A1F2; NAS - 3, fibrosis - 2). Quercetin-treated rats exhibited in liver significantly less steatosis without significant changes in inflammation and fibrosis features (S1A1F2; NAS - 2, fibrosis - 2) compared with rats of the 2 nd group. Conclusion. The data obtained demonstrate the ability of quercetin to inhibit the development of NAFLD in rats fed a diet with a high content of fructose, by reducing the severity of hepatostatosis.
